摘要
The product taxonomy can provide knowledge support for many knowledge-based Web services. Merging different taxonomies is an effective way to build a complete product taxonomy. To achieve this goal, a core task is to align the concepts of different taxonomies. The traditional methods of conceptual alignment are insufficient in accuracy and efficiency. In this paper, we propose a new concept alignment by integrating three factors simultaneously: the concept's path semantic, topic similarity and dictionary-based semantic similarity. A series of experiments on real datasets show that the proposed method has a great improvement on the accuracy and efficiency of concept alignment.
